Condensation If the unit is suddenly taken from a cold to a warm location, or if ambient temperature suddenly rises, moisture may form on the outer surface of the unit and/or inside of the unit. This is known as condensation. If condensation occurs, turn off the unit and wait until the condensation clears before operating the unit. Operating the unit while condensation is present may damage the unit. Security
- Depending on the operating environment, una utho rized third parties on the network may be able to access the unit. When connecting the unit to the network, be sure to confirm that the network is protected securely. Burn-in Permanent burn-in may occur if a still image is displayed for a prolonged period of time. Playing a video with moving images may reduce the severity of burn-in once it occurs, but it will not remove the burn-in completely. Defective pixels Thus a very small proportion of pixels may be “stuck,” either always off (black), always on (red, green, or blue), or flashing. In addition, such “stuck” pixels may appear spontaneously over a long period of use due to the physical characteristics of the organic light-emitting diodes. Such occurrences do not indicate a malfunction. om a service representative. Precautions regarding the effect on medical devices The display cabinet uses strong magnets. There are areas where the magnetic flux density is
kely to be 300 mT or more on the surface that is touched during installation or maintenance work.19
Please Read This First This may seriously affect medical devices such as defibrillators, pacemakers, and programmable shunt valves for hydrocephalus treatment. Keep users of these medical devices away from
as where installation and maintenance work is being performed or where display cabinets are stored. There is also magnetic flux leakage from the
wing surface, which may affect users of these medical devices when they approach the display cabinet. Take measures such as posting warning signs
pending on the installation conditions. Be sure to inform the contractor who undertakes the inst allation or maintenance work about these effects. Precautions on visually induced motion sickness (VIMS) and postural instability Depending on the displayed content, display size, and viewing location (distance), a viewer may experience VIMS symptoms such as postural instability or nausea. The symptoms of VIMS may be severer after some
me rather than during or immediately after viewing. Take measures such as posting warning signs. Furthermore, the movement in one direction in a
de part of the image may induce postural instability. Pay close attention to the displayed contents and installation location (direction) when installing the product in a position where it can be seen from stairs, escalators, landings, or other places that are considered dangerous when posture is unstable.

Overview Overview Connect cabinets to make a display cabinet screen according to the installation location and purpose, and video contents input in the Display Controller are output to the Display Cabinet by converting the signal. Depending on the products, the Display Controller differs. Use the following products. ZRD-VP15EB/VP23EB: Brompton Technology Tessera SX40 Processor, Tessera XD Data Distribution Unit ZRD-VP15EM/VP23EM: Megapixel LED Processing Platform HELIOS, Network Switch MSM4214X/GSM4210P Daisy-chain connections can be configured between Display Cabinets using a power cord (not supplied)
d an ethernet cable (not supplied). For the controller’s maximum controllable connection numbers, the controller’s control method and the used ethernet cable’s specification, refer to the operating instructions of the display controller system you will be using.
